The objective of this work was to estimate the allele polymorphism frequencies of genes in Nellore cattle and associate them with meat quality and carcass traits. Six hundred males were genotyped for the following polymorphisms: DGAT1 (VNTR with 18 nucleotides at the promoter region); ANK1, a new polymorphism, identified and mapped here at the gene regulatory region NW_001494427.3; TCAP (AY428575.1:g.346G>A); and MYOG (NW_001501985:g.511G>C). In the association study, phenotype data of hot carcass weight, ribeye area, backfat thickness, percentage of intramuscular fat, shear force, myofibrillar fragmentation index, meat color (L*, a*, b*), and cooking losses were used. ABSTRACT The objective of this research was to discern the contribution of genomic information to multiple-trait breeding objectives and thus understand the economic value of that information. True genetic values were simulated for each of n, possibly correlated, traits. These true genetic values, combined with uncorrelated random noise, resulted in both genomic and phenotypic estimated breeding values, EBVg and EBVp, respectively. The separate EBV were then merged (blended) as a function of their respective accuracies to produce a unified EBV for each of the n traits.
